Executive Summary
The Trajectory So Far
The Business Implication
Stakeholder Perspectives
In an era defined by rapid digital transformation, businesses are increasingly reliant on Software-as-a-Service (SaaS) applications to power their operations, leading to a pervasive challenge: hidden SaaS costs. A company-wide app audit is the critical process by which organizations systematically identify, analyze, and optimize their SaaS subscriptions, revealing expenditures that often go unnoticed across departments. This comprehensive review is essential for any modern enterprise, allowing them to reclaim control over their technology spending, mitigate security risks, and enhance operational efficiency in a technology landscape where SaaS proliferation is the norm.
The Rise of SaaS Sprawl and Shadow IT
SaaS sprawl refers to the uncontrolled growth in the number of SaaS applications used within an organization, often without centralized oversight. The ease of adoption, where individual teams or employees can subscribe to new tools with a credit card, contributes significantly to this phenomenon. While empowering, this decentralized procurement can lead to a fragmented technology ecosystem.
This sprawl often gives rise to “shadow IT,” where departments or employees use applications not approved or managed by the central IT department. Shadow IT introduces significant risks, including data breaches, compliance violations, and inefficient resource allocation. Without a clear understanding of all active subscriptions, companies struggle to manage their digital assets effectively.
Why a Comprehensive SaaS Audit is Indispensable
Conducting a thorough SaaS audit offers a multitude of benefits that directly impact a company’s bottom line and operational integrity. Primarily, it serves as a powerful tool for cost optimization, uncovering redundant applications, underutilized licenses, and forgotten subscriptions that drain budgets unnecessarily. This financial clarity allows businesses to reallocate resources more strategically.
Beyond cost savings, an audit is crucial for bolstering an organization’s security posture. Unmanaged or unauthorized applications can create vulnerabilities, acting as potential entry points for cyber threats or leading to data compliance issues. By identifying and assessing every application, IT teams can ensure all software adheres to security protocols and regulatory requirements.
Furthermore, an audit improves operational efficiency by streamlining the technology stack. Eliminating overlapping tools and consolidating functionalities can reduce complexity, improve data flow, and enhance user productivity. It also provides valuable insights for better vendor negotiations, enabling companies to leverage their aggregated usage for more favorable contract terms.
Executing a Successful Company-Wide App Audit
A structured approach is vital for a comprehensive SaaS audit, ensuring no stone is left unturned. This process typically involves several key phases, from initial discovery to strategic optimization.
Inventory All SaaS Applications
The first step is to create a complete inventory of every SaaS application currently in use across the organization. This can be a challenging task, as many subscriptions may not be centrally tracked. Methods for discovery include reviewing financial records for recurring charges, analyzing IT logs from single sign-on (SSO) providers, examining network traffic, and conducting employee surveys to identify tools used at the departmental level.
Once identified, each application should be logged in a centralized repository. This database should include details such as the application name, vendor, subscription cost, billing cycle, and the department or individual responsible for its use. This foundational data is critical for subsequent analysis.
Identify Owners and Usage Patterns
For each inventoried application, it is essential to determine who owns the subscription and who actively uses it. Understanding usage patterns involves assessing the number of active users, the frequency of use, and the specific features being utilized. This step helps in identifying underutilized licenses or applications that may have been adopted by a single team but offer broader organizational value.
Engaging with departmental heads and end-users provides valuable qualitative data on how these tools support daily workflows. This insight can reveal critical applications versus those that are merely “nice-to-have” or redundant. It also helps to uncover instances where employees are using unapproved tools due to perceived gaps in official software offerings.
Assess Value, Necessity, and Overlap
With a clear picture of ownership and usage, the next phase involves evaluating the actual value each application brings to the business. Assess whether the application’s functionality is critical to business operations, if it provides a strong return on investment (ROI), and if its features overlap with other existing tools. For example, multiple project management or communication platforms often exist within the same company.
This assessment should involve stakeholders from relevant departments to determine if an application is still necessary or if its function can be absorbed by another, more comprehensive tool. Prioritizing applications based on their strategic importance and user satisfaction is key to making informed decisions about consolidation or elimination.
Evaluate Security and Compliance Posture
Every SaaS application introduces a potential security vector, making a thorough security and compliance review imperative. This involves scrutinizing the vendor’s security practices, data handling policies, and adherence to relevant industry regulations (e.g., GDPR, HIPAA, CCPA). Companies must ensure that all third-party applications meet internal security standards and comply with legal obligations.
Assess the type of data handled by each application, how it is stored, and who has access. Unauthorized applications, especially those handling sensitive information, pose significant risks that must be addressed immediately. This review helps to identify “shadow IT” instances that could lead to severe data breaches or regulatory penalties.
Analyze Contract Terms and Renewal Dates
Finally, a detailed review of all contract terms, including pricing models, renewal dates, and cancellation clauses, is essential. Many SaaS subscriptions automatically renew, often at higher rates, if not actively managed. Understanding these terms provides opportunities for negotiation, consolidation, or timely cancellation before unnecessary expenses are incurred.
Identifying upcoming renewal dates allows procurement teams to strategically engage with vendors. This leverage can result in better pricing, improved service level agreements (SLAs), or the opportunity to transition to a more suitable alternative if the current solution no longer meets organizational needs.
Strategies for Optimization and Cost Reduction
Once the audit is complete, the focus shifts to actionable strategies for optimization. This includes consolidating overlapping tools to reduce redundancy and licensing costs. For instance, if multiple teams use different video conferencing solutions, standardizing on one can yield significant savings and simplify management.
Downgrading underutilized subscriptions to lower-tier plans or eliminating unused licenses entirely are straightforward ways to cut costs. Leveraging the audit’s insights, businesses can negotiate more favorable terms with vendors, especially for critical applications with high usage. Implementing stricter procurement policies and centralized SaaS management platforms can prevent future SaaS sprawl and maintain ongoing visibility.
Sustaining SaaS Hygiene Beyond the Audit
A one-time audit is a powerful start, but maintaining SaaS hygiene requires continuous effort. Establishing clear, company-wide SaaS procurement policies ensures that all new applications undergo proper vetting before adoption. Regular review cycles, perhaps quarterly or semi-annually, are crucial for tracking usage, costs, and compliance over time. Investing in a dedicated SaaS management platform can automate much of this process, providing real-time visibility and control.
Ultimately, a proactive approach to SaaS management, driven by regular audits and clear policies, transforms a potential cost sink into a strategic asset. By understanding and optimizing their SaaS ecosystem, businesses can achieve significant cost savings, enhance their security posture, and empower their teams with the right tools, thereby fostering sustainable growth and innovation.
